    Equity-linked notes in the cryptocurrency market are financial instruments that offer investors exposure to the performance of an underlying cryptocurrency, such as Bitcoin or Ethereum. These notes are typically structured as debt securities with a fixed maturity date and a variable return based on the price movements of the underlying cryptocurrency. Some examples of equity-linked notes in the cryptocurrency market include structured products offered by major investment banks and financial institutions. These notes often come with features like principal protection or enhanced returns, depending on the specific terms and conditions. Investors can participate in the potential upside of the cryptocurrency market while also having some level of downside protection.

    Equity-linked notes in the cryptocurrency market are like a hybrid investment that combines elements of traditional debt securities and exposure to the cryptocurrency market. They allow investors to gain exposure to the price movements of cryptocurrencies without directly owning them. Examples of equity-linked notes in the cryptocurrency market include products offered by specialized cryptocurrency investment firms. These firms create structured notes that track the performance of specific cryptocurrencies or cryptocurrency indexes. The return on these notes is typically linked to the price movements of the underlying cryptocurrency, and investors can benefit from potential price appreciation while also having the option to receive fixed interest payments.
